Hi Have You tested this patient for anti phospholipid syndrome?? I have a large experience in this syndrom and sometimes can give exactly the same I am seing at Your sonogram. And the repeted abortion.

>Fetal bradycardia. (less than 85 BPM). There is a more than 90% chance
>of bad outcome (abortion). Does she have spotting? or pain abdomen?
